CAIRO - Three of Africa’s five World Cup finalists could find themselves in the same group at the 2006 African Nations Cup finals when the draw for the tournament is made on Thursday.

Tunisia are the only team of the continent’s World Cup qualifiers to be named among the four top seeds for the finals, hosted in Egypt from January 20.

Tunisia face the distinct possibility of being paired with Angola and one of Ghana, the Ivory Coast or Togo in the same group when the draw is conducted against the backdrop of the Pyramids in Cairo.

The top seeds are the hosts Egypt, Cameroon, Nigeria and Tunisia.
